Output 56c2996c763d4f66f6693506b1c5bd16bcd76a44f9f66ffcc0733711e8e605ae:1

value
804408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d43f183a893a1f00a3218aba032c573283a2eb5e OP_EQUAL
address
3M3Gm71gJB2tYGanrWYJMSMgqpr4e5ZDNL
transaction
56c2996c763d4f66f6693506b1c5bd16bcd76a44f9f66ffcc0733711e8e605ae
spent
true